GITHUB

LINKEDIN

Back to Experience

DockerDocker

Docker

NestJSNestJS

NestJS

PostgreSQLPostgreSQL

PostgreSQL

ReactReact

React

PythonPython

Python

AirflowAirflow

Airflow

AnsibleAnsible

Ansible

NginxNginx

Nginx

Picture of the author
Picture of the author
AirflowAirflow
DockerDocker
PythonPython

AirFlow

Development of an automated monitoring system (PINGER) using AirFlow to check the availability of our web applications and monitor the validity of SSL certificates across our domains.

Picture of the author
Picture of the author
AnsibleAnsible
DockerDocker
GitLabGitLab
NginxNginx

Apache to Nginx Migration

Led a complete migration from Apache to Nginx, leveraging Ansible and Docker to implement a robust CI/CD pipeline. This project involved reconfiguring and managing multiple servers responsible for HTTP request routing, ensuring efficient redirection to the appropriate machines and services. The migration improved performance, scalability, and deployment automation across the infrastructure.

Picture of the author
Picture of the author
DockerDocker
MistralMistral
NestJSNestJS
OllamaOllama
PythonPython
ReactReact

LLM IA

Development of an AI-powered career guidance advisor, leveraging embeddings from a generic LLM to provide personalized recommendations and generate tailored career pathways.

Picture of the author
Picture of the author
AzureAzure
DockerDocker
NestJSNestJS
PostgreSQLPostgreSQL
ReactReact

Match4Cooperation

Match4Cooperation (M4C) is a social network developed by the Ulysseus European University Alliance to connect researchers and academic staff, foster collaboration, and increase visibility of European research funding opportunities. Accessible via mobile app or web version, M4C allows Ulysseus members to log in using their university credentials, while guests can join by invitation. The platform facilitates interaction, tracking of research activity, and partner search via the dedicated @projects group. M4C supports researcher mobility and strengthens a collaborative academic community within the Ulysseus alliance.

Picture of the author
Picture of the author
DockerDocker
NestJSNestJS
PostgreSQLPostgreSQL
ReactReact

Member Curriculum

This project scrapes the websites of Ulysseus alliance institutions to collect available degree programs. The data is then centralized into a single training directory accessible to students. This system not only better informs students about opportunities within the alliance but also supports double-degree development by identifying similar programs in the same field across institutions (developed entirely from scratch: frontend, backend, and production deployment).

Picture of the author
Picture of the author
AzureAzure
DockerDocker
ReactReact

Microsoft - Azure

Automated the process of adding new users to the Ulysseus tenant via a Python script, making access management and onboarding easier.

Picture of the author
Picture of the author
DockerDocker
PostgreSQLPostgreSQL
PythonPython
ReactReact

Open Science Repository

Match4Cooperation (M4C) is a social network developed by the Ulysseus European University Alliance to connect researchers and academic staff, foster collaboration, and increase visibility of European research funding opportunities. Accessible via mobile app or web version, M4C allows Ulysseus members to log in using their university credentials, while guests can join by invitation. The platform facilitates interaction, tracking of research activity, and partner search via the dedicated @projects group. M4C supports researcher mobility and strengthens a collaborative academic community within the Ulysseus alliance.

Picture of the author
Picture of the author
DockerDocker
ReactReact

Servers Details

Automated the retrieval of detailed server information, including performance, status, and configuration data, with Excel report generation for easy tracking and analysis.

Picture of the author
Picture of the author
DockerDocker
NestJSNestJS
PostgreSQLPostgreSQL
ReactReact

Student Portal

Development of a centralized student portal to display events and activities across campuses, improving information access and student participation. The portal includes features such as listing degree programs offered by Ulysseus, job offers from each institution and surrounding areas, a chat system, and a housing exchange platform to help students find accommodation during exchanges. The app focuses on supporting student mobility.

Picture of the author
Picture of the author
AzureAzure
DockerDocker
NestJSNestJS
PythonPython
ReactReact

ToolBox